This bug was fixed in the package linux-azure - 4.15.0-1112.124~16.04.1

---------------
linux-azure (4.15.0-1112.124~16.04.1) xenial; urgency=medium

  * xenial/linux-azure: 4.15.0-1112.124~16.04.1 -proposed tracker (LP: #1919516)

  [ Ubuntu: 4.15.0-1112.124 ]

  * bionic/linux-azure-4.15: 4.15.0-1112.124 -proposed tracker (LP: #1919518)
  * Please trust Canonical Livepatch Service kmod signing key (LP: #1898716)
    - [Config] azure: enable CONFIG_MODVERSIONS and CONFIG_ASM_MODVERSIONS
  * Enforce CONFIG_DRM_BOCHS=m (LP: #1916290)
    - [Config] azure: Keep CONFIG_DRM_BOCHS disabled
  * linux-azure: Install PMEM modules by default (LP: #1921411)
    - [Packaging] azure: Move PMEM related modules to linux-modules
  * Fix close/open corner cases (LP: #1918714)
    - CIFS: Close open handle after interrupted close
    - CIFS: Do not miss cancelled OPEN responses
    - cifs: Fix memory allocation in __smb2_handle_cancelled_cmd()
  * bionic/linux: 4.15.0-141.145 -proposed tracker (LP: #1919536)
  * binary assembly failures with CONFIG_MODVERSIONS present (LP: #1919315)
    - [Packaging] quiet (nomially) benign errors in BUILD script
  * selftests: bpf verifier fails after sanitize_ptr_alu fixes (LP: #1920995)
    - bpf: Simplify alu_limit masking for pointer arithmetic
    - bpf: Add sanity check for upper ptr_limit
    - bpf, selftests: Fix up some test_verifier cases for unprivileged
  * Packaging resync (LP: #1786013)
    - update dkms package versions
  * CVE-2018-13095
    - xfs: More robust inode extent count validation
  * i40e PF reset due to incorrect MDD event (LP: #1772675)
    - i40e: change behavior on PF in response to MDD event
  * Bionic update: upstream stable patchset 2021-03-09 (LP: #1918330)
    - ACPI: sysfs: Prefer "compatible" modalias
    - ARM: dts: imx6qdl-gw52xx: fix duplicate regulator naming
    - wext: fix NULL-ptr-dereference with cfg80211's lack of commit()
    - net: usb: qmi_wwan: added support for Thales Cinterion PLSx3 modem family
    - drivers: soc: atmel: Avoid calling at91_soc_init on non AT91 SoCs
    - drivers: soc: atmel: add null entry at the end of at91_soc_allowed_list[]
    - KVM: x86/pmu: Fix HW_REF_CPU_CYCLES event pseudo-encoding in
      intel_arch_events[]
    - KVM: x86: get smi pending status correctly
    - xen: Fix XenStore initialisation for XS_LOCAL
    - leds: trigger: fix potential deadlock with libata
    - mt7601u: fix kernel crash unplugging the device
    - mt7601u: fix rx buffer refcounting
    - xen-blkfront: allow discard-* nodes to be optional
    - ARM: imx: build suspend-imx6.S with arm instruction set
    - netfilter: nft_dynset: add timeout extension to template
    - xfrm: Fix oops in xfrm_replay_advance_bmp
    - RDMA/cxgb4: Fix the reported max_recv_sge value
    - iwlwifi: pcie: use jiffies for memory read spin time limit
    - iwlwifi: pcie: reschedule in long-running memory reads
    - mac80211: pause TX while changing interface type
    - can: dev: prevent potential information leak in can_fill_info()
    - x86/entry/64/compat: Preserve r8-r11 in int $0x80
    - x86/entry/64/compat: Fix "x86/entry/64/compat: Preserve r8-r11 in int $0x80"
